Optimizing Your Sectional Couch for Small Spaces

If your sectional couch is the centerpiece of your small living room, there are several ways to make it work effectively. For example, consider using a slimline or low-profile sectional design that takes up less space. Alternatively, you can place the sofa against a wall to create a cozy nook and use the remaining floor space for other furniture pieces.

Choosing the Right Fabric

The type of fabric you choose for your sectional couch can greatly impact the overall aesthetic of your small living room. Consider using lighter-colored fabrics or those with a subtle pattern to help make the room feel more spacious. You can also use throw pillows and blankets in bold colors to add pops of color and create visual interest.

Creating a Focal Point

In a small living room, it’s essential to create a focal point that draws the eye away from the limited space. This could be a stunning piece of artwork, a statement light fixture, or even a beautifully styled coffee table. By creating a visual anchor, you can distract from the room’s size and create a sense of grandeur.

Using Mirrors Wisely

Mirrors are a great way to make a small living room feel larger. Hang a large mirror above the sectional couch or place a few smaller mirrors around the room to create the illusion of more space. Just be sure to choose frames that complement your decor and don’t overwhelm the senses.

Maximizing Vertical Space

In a small living room, it’s essential to make the most of vertical space. Use floor-to-ceiling curtains or drapes to draw the eye upwards and create a sense of height. You can also use tall vases or sculptures to add visual interest and distract from the room’s size.

Displaying Decor

When it comes to displaying decorative items in a small living room, it’s essential to keep things simple and uncluttered. Use floating shelves or a minimalist coffee table to create a sense of openness, and choose decorative items that are visually appealing but don’t take up too much space.

Adding Texture and Pattern

To make a small living room feel more interesting, incorporate texture and pattern through your furniture choices. Use a sectional couch with a chunky knit or a rug with a bold pattern to add depth and visual interest. You can also use throw blankets and pillows in different textures to create a cozy atmosphere.

Using Plants Wisely

Adding plants to your small living room can be a great way to bring in some natural beauty, but it’s essential to choose the right types for the space. Opt for compact or trailing plants that won’t overwhelm the senses, and consider using planters with a sleek design to keep things visually appealing.

Lighting Ideas for Small Living Rooms

Lighting can make a huge difference in a small living room, so be sure to choose fixtures that create ambiance without overwhelming the space. Consider using table lamps or floor lamps to create pools of light, and use string lights or candles to add warmth and coziness.

Saving Space with Multi-Functional Furniture

When it comes to decorating a small living room, every inch counts. Look for multi-functional furniture pieces that can serve multiple purposes, such as an ottoman with storage or a coffee table with a lift-top surface. This will help keep the space feeling open and uncluttered.
